diff options
author | sem <sem@FreeBSD.org> | 2005-07-31 19:38:02 +0800 |
---|---|---|
committer | sem <sem@FreeBSD.org> | 2005-07-31 19:38:02 +0800 |
commit | 721623d00fddc3b4ad68af05830117321a124157 (patch) | |
tree | 8d6ff7b6382f4b1da5adfdd37cf055fa6ffc5624 | |
parent | 7403dc25cb8e72fe82e0828077b2597e4a4fe85f (diff) | |
download | freebsd-ports-gnome-721623d00fddc3b4ad68af05830117321a124157.tar.gz freebsd-ports-gnome-721623d00fddc3b4ad68af05830117321a124157.tar.zst freebsd-ports-gnome-721623d00fddc3b4ad68af05830117321a124157.zip |
- Unbreak on CURRENT
PR: ports/84228
Submitted by: maintainer
-rw-r--r-- | sysutils/symon/files/patch-sm_io.c | 29 |
1 files changed, 29 insertions, 0 deletions
diff --git a/sysutils/symon/files/patch-sm_io.c b/sysutils/symon/files/patch-sm_io.c new file mode 100644 index 000000000000..f1d898f2736c --- /dev/null +++ b/sysutils/symon/files/patch-sm_io.c @@ -0,0 +1,29 @@ +--- platform/FreeBSD/sm_io.c.orig Mon Jul 25 12:08:47 2005 ++++ platform/FreeBSD/sm_io.c Mon Jul 25 12:12:27 2005 +@@ -81,7 +81,7 @@ + void + gets_io() + { +-#if DEVSTAT_USER_API_VER == 5 ++#if DEVSTAT_USER_API_VER == 5 || DEVSTAT_USER_API_VER == 6 + io_numdevs = devstat_getnumdevs(NULL); + #else + io_numdevs = getnumdevs(); +@@ -98,7 +98,7 @@ + /* clear the devinfo struct, as getdevs expects it to be all zeroes */ + bzero(io_stats.dinfo, sizeof(struct devinfo)); + +-#if DEVSTAT_USER_API_VER == 5 ++#if DEVSTAT_USER_API_VER == 5 || DEVSTAT_USER_API_VER == 6 + devstat_getdevs(NULL, &io_stats); + #else + getdevs(&io_stats); +@@ -118,7 +118,7 @@ + strlen(ds->device_name) < strlen(dev) && + isdigit(dev[strlen(ds->device_name)]) && + atoi(&dev[strlen(ds->device_name)]) == ds->unit_number) { +-#if DEVSTAT_USER_API_VER == 5 ++#if DEVSTAT_USER_API_VER == 5 || DEVSTAT_USER_API_VER == 6 + return snpack(symon_buf, maxlen, dev, MT_IO2, + ds->operations[DEVSTAT_READ], + ds->operations[DEVSTAT_WRITE], |